May 2025 - Apr 2026Egerton Hall Cottages area has the 26th lowest crime rate of 58 local areas in Audlem , and the 522nd lowest crime rate of 1,263 local areas in Cheshire East .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Egerton Hall Cottages (SY14 8AG) in the last 12 months was 33.7 per 1,000 residents and was 4.5% lower than the Audlem average (35.3 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 7 offences recorded. The least common crime was Vehicle crime with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.
Violent crimes totalled 7 (≈ 21.5 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 75.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-81.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.
